Mount Smith ({{Coord|76|3|S|161|42|E||display=inline,title}}) is a mountain over 1,400 m, standing north of Mawson Glacier and 7 miles (11 km) north-northwest of Mount Murray in Victoria Land, Antarctica. Discovered by the Discovery Expedition (1901–04), which probably named this peak for W. E.
